Compound Interest
In this method, interest is accrued on the principal sum as well as on the interest that has been accumulated over prior periods of the investment or loan.
Earnings Rate
The rate of return on an investment or the rate at which a company or asset is generating income, often expressed as a percentage.
Capital Rationing
A financial strategy employed by companies to limit or restrict the amount of new investments or projects they undertake due to limited resources.
Investment Capital
Funds invested in a business by its owners or shareholders with the expectation of generating a return, used for acquiring assets or financing operations.
